Summerlee is the main homestead of Summerlee Station – a 5,000 acre farm which includes the world famous gannet colony at Cape Kidnappers and several miles of spectacular Hawkes Bay coastline. While totally private and secluded Summerlee is just 25 minutes from Napier Airport, 15 minutes from the city of Hastings and many of Hawkes Bay’s best wineries and attractions are just a short distance from the driveway. Built in 1926 Summerlee is a large and generously proportioned homestead. It has been substantially renovated to provide luxurious and private accommodation for up to 12 people. There are three large master bedrooms with their own bathrooms upstairs plus an additional 5 bedrooms and two bathrooms as required. Downstairs is a professional kitchen with top of the range appliances, cutlery and plateware. Summerlees kitchen has its own breakfast living area with French doors opening out onto sunny terraces. There is a separate formal dining room which opens into a large sitting room. The dining and sitting rooms have open fires and gas central heating warms the entire house. The Summerlee house is beautifully furnished with the very best of soft natural fabrics, luxurious bedding and antique furniture.
